WebCyclophosphamide, 1,000 mg/m2 IV, is given over 1 hour on days 2 and 3. On the first day of administration, cyclophosphamide should be given at least 24 hours after cisplatin. Mesna, 360 mg/m2, is given IV with cyclophosphamide infusion and 3 and 6 hours after cyclophosphamide. WebDec 15, 2002 · PURPOSE To investigate whether chemotherapy with etoposide and cisplatin (EP) is superior to cyclophosphamide, epirubicin, and vincristine (CEV) in small-cell lung cancer (SCLC). PATIENTS AND METHODS A total of 436 eligible patients were randomized to chemotherapy with EP (n = 218) or CEV (n = 218).
